How to select recipes in your trial box
During your sign up, on the ‘My Plan’ page, we’ll break down a list of the recipes we recommend for your cat’s trial box.
We include 14 trays in the 2 week trial box, which is 28 portions in total. Each tray is made up of 2 daily portions, labelled morning and evening (but you can split the portions differently if your cat prefers.)
Based on their age and any allergies you tell us they have, we’ll include a selection of 14 trays from our 7 recipes.
For allergens, we won’t include recipes which contain allergens you’ve added and you won’t be able to select these either.
For kittens (cats below 1 year of age), they won’t be able to see our Baaa recipe. This recipe is our only recipe which isn’t yet suitable for kittens. But good news, once they hit a year old, it’ll appear in your account to add to future boxes!
If you’d like to edit this selection and choose recipes yourself just click ‘See other recipes’.
Tip! You’ll need to decrease other trays first, before you add new ones to your selection. Once you’ve selected 14, you won’t be able to add more, until you remove others.
You’ll need to have a combination of 14 trays selected to continue on, as this is the minimum amount of food in our trial box.

If your cat typically prefers fish 🐟
We currently have one fish recipe available, Splash. It’s made of 100% gently-cooked whitefish, salmon and a small amount of turkey liver.
Cats who love supermarket fish recipes don’t always love Splash straight away. That’s because fish flavoured cat food tins and sachets usually contain more poultry than fish, to improve the taste of the food.
We recommend only adding 1-2 Splash trays to your box if this is the case, and mixing Splash with Cluck or Gobble to help your cat get used to the new taste in the beginning.
Tip! You can also add our chicken Sprinkles meal topper to their Splash, to help make it more similar to the food they’re used to.
